## Deploying the Gatewick Proctor Queue

Deploys are pretty painless: push to main, wait for the pipeline, then watch the queue drain dashboard for five minutes. If candidates pile up mid-exam, roll back first and ask questions later — the queue replays safely. Everything the workers care about lives in one config block, shown here for reference.

settings of bafof-yagef:
JOROX_PIN=8740
JOROX_TENANT=pelox
JOROX_METRICS_HOST=metrics.jorox.qorvelworks.internal
JOROX_SEAL=seal_c78f63c1
JOROX_STANDBY_TEAM=norax

### Fee Rules Engine — Evaluation Order

The Parcelwright engine evaluates rules by priority, first match wins. Surcharges stack; base fees do not. Reviewers: check that zone overrides precede carrier defaults, and that the fallback rule is terminal. Caps are enforced post-stacking. The tuning constants are defined below.

constants for tageg-kagag:
QUOTAS = {
    "kelax": 495,
    "istath": 366,
    "tammir": 108,
    "novdor": 730,
    "casax": 816,
    "quenael": 874,
    "pelius": 403,
}

// Broker upgrade notes for plugin authors:
// Quillbus 4.x replaces the legacy 3.x wire protocol. Plugins must
// construct the client with explicit protocol negotiation enabled,
// or connections to the Larkfield cluster will be silently downgraded
// and dropped after 30s. Topic names are unchanged. For local testing
// against the sandbox broker, authenticate with the key below.

API key for bafof-bagaf: qvz2-qi

Finance Review — Larkspan Pilot

Pilot with the Merrowby retail chain closed its first quarter. Revenue slightly above plan; margin thin due to fit-out costs at the Aldercross sites. Returns rate acceptable. Staffing model needs trimming before any rollout. Decision point is next review cycle. Heads of department should hold expansion commitments until then. The related planning note follows below.

management briefing: Project Istwyn slips by one quarter because of the staffing delay.